The Original background for Tyranid Squigs aka Ripper Swarms amounts to this:

The Tyranids captured Orks, and genetically engineered them into the squigs/rippers of the Tyranids. Orks hearing of this, stormed Tyranid hive ships to rescue their compatriots. Discovering them transformed as squigs the Orks were enraged but enough of the latent orkiness remained in the squigs that they recognised the Orks and the Orks them, as kin. The Orks gathered as many squigs as they could as they retreated from the hive ships and over many generations cultivated and evolved the squigs towards the Ork squigs of today, whilst the tyranids evolved them to iron our all orky free will and make them distinctly Tyranid!

This is rather awesome and it's a shame that these early squig/ripper swarm origins have been removed from the codicices and overall fluff of recent editions (well even 2nd edition for a large part).

Complete List as per the catalogue:

5* Big squig 1 (Grabber Slasher)
5* Big Squig 2 (Large Spider)
24* Squig 3 (Rat Squig)
21* Squig 4 (Squig Hound)
16* Squig 5 (Small Spider Squig)
20* Squig 6 (Stilt Squig)
5* Squig 7 (Mohawk Squig)
14* Squig 8 (Medium Round Squig)
16* Squig 9 (Small Round Squig)
16* Squig 10 (Stegadon Squig)
13* Squig 11 (Slimer Squig)
18* Squig 12 (Tiny Round Squig)

9*Shaggy Haired Familiars/Squigs??
3* Random Squig/Familiars???
9* Running Mouth Open Familiar/Squig???

23* Genestealer Familiars

217 total models

54.25 bases of 4 (6 troops choices of 9 bases)

(so 1 spare model!)
